🔍 1. What Is an Aspirating Smoke Detector (ASD)?
An #aspiratingsmokedetector is a high-sensitivity smoke detection system that actively pulls in air from a protected area through a network of small pipes. The air is then analyzed inside a detection chamber using laser-based sensors or high-efficiency optical detectors.
Unlike traditional smoke alarms that wait passively, ASDs actively monitor the air — constantly and quietly.

🚨 2. Why Do We Need ASD Systems Today?
With the world getting denser and more technology-driven, early detection of fire is not a luxury — it’s a life-saving necessity.
✅ Suitable for:
Data centers
Cold storage units
Power plants
Clean rooms
Museums & libraries
Warehouses with high ceilings
✅ Solves problems like:
Delayed detection in large spaces
#Smoke dissipation in ventilated areas
Dust interference in traditional detectors
False alarms due to non-combustible particles

🧠 3. What Makes Aspirating Smoke Detectors Smarter Than the Rest?
Here’s what sets ASD apart from conventional smoke detection:
Feature | Traditional Detector | Aspirating Smoke Detector |
Smoke Detection | Passive | Active |
Response Time | Delayed | Ultra-early |
Sensitivity | Low–Medium | High to ultra-high |
Area Coverage | Limited | Wide & complex zones |
Application | Residential/Basic commercial | Critical environments |
⚙️ 4. How Does an ASD Work? (Technical Flow)
Air Sampling: Air is drawn via small capillary pipes installed across rooms or enclosures.
Filtration: Dust and particles are filtered out.
Detection Chamber: The clean air enters a laser-based chamber.
Analysis: Smoke particles, even of sub-micron size, are detected.
Alarm Decision: The system decides whether to raise an alert — intelligently, often in multiple stages.

🧱 11. Installation Insights
Don't DIY — ASD systems require professional design & calibration.
Key factors for design:
Ceiling height
Air flow pattern
Occupancy type
Obstruction mapping
Sensitivity requirements
Notofire’s engineers design systems using international standards (EN 54-20, UL 268) and custom software tools to ensure precise performance.
